Okay, here's a wierd problem. 3 times now my windshield wipers have come on without me turning them on. The last time was just this morning. They stay on for 10-15 minutes then stop. They wipe at only one speed. Turning off the engine and restarting does not help. This happens only when I am driving the car, never when my wife drives. We have electric seats. I weigh 240 lbs. My wife weighes 130 lbs. I belive there is a short somewhere that my weight on the seat is activating. This does not happen every time I drive which makes it more difficult to diagnose. Subaru dealer thinks I'm batty. They say they checked and could not find a problem. Anybody else have this problem?

Strange problem indeed.
 
I would look under the seat to make sure there aren't any pinched wires or something like that, maybe use tie-straps to tie loose ones.
